INSIGHT

Search Results Become AI-Generated Pages

  • Gemini 3 can generate full interactive webpages and visuals for informational search queries instead of linking to existing sites.
  • This reduces organic traffic for how-to and unbranded searches and changes discovery dynamics.
INSIGHT

Google Frames AI As A Creator Tool

  • Google frames the feature as a tool to visualize your own data and content, which helps justify adoption to creators.
  • They still need user-generated content to keep AI answers current and accurate.
INSIGHT

Monetization Drives Google's AI Search Shift

  • AI-generated interactive pages create premium real estate where Google can place richer ads and revive its ad model.
  • That monetization incentive drives Google to shift search toward synthetic answers.
